MARKET DRIVERS
Rising Water Scarcity is Driving Market Growth
Rising global water scarcity is driving the growth of the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Increasing demand for potable water is accelerating investments in desalination and advanced water treatment, where RO membranes play a critical role in delivering high-quality purified water.
Expansion of Desalination Infrastructure is Expanding Market Share
The expansion of desalination infrastructure is expanding the market share of the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Growing investments in large-scale desalination facilities are increasing demand for high-performance RO membranes used in seawater and brackish water treatment.
-
According to the European Commission, there were more than 22,000 operational desalination plants worldwide with a combined capacity of approximately 135 million m³/day in 2024. Continued investment in desalination infrastructure is driving demand for RO membrane technologies.
Increasing Wastewater Reuse Initiatives are Driving Market Demand
Increasing wastewater reuse initiatives are driving demand in the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Governments and industries are expanding water recycling programs to improve water security, creating greater demand for advanced RO membrane systems.
MARKET CHALLENGES
Membrane Fouling and Scaling Restrain Market Growth
Membrane fouling and scaling are restraining the growth of the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Biofouling, organic deposits, and mineral scaling reduce membrane efficiency, increase maintenance requirements, and shorten membrane service life.
High Energy Consumption Challenges Market Demand
High energy consumption is challenging demand in the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Although RO is more energy-efficient than thermal desalination, electricity remains a significant operating expense for large-scale desalination and water treatment facilities.
Brine Disposal and Environmental Concerns Challenge Market Growth
Brine disposal and environmental concerns are challenging the growth of the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Managing concentrated brine streams increases disposal costs and raises concerns about potential impacts on marine ecosystems.
MARKET OPPORTUNITIES
Growing Water Reuse Projects are Emerging as a Key Market Trend
Growing water reuse projects are emerging as a key trend in the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Increasing investments in potable reuse, industrial recycling, and zero-liquid-discharge (ZLD) systems are creating new opportunities for advanced RO membrane technologies.
-
According to UN-Water, the untapped potential for wastewater reuse is approximately 320 billion m³ per year, which could supply more than 10 times the current global desalination capacity. The significant potential to expand water reuse is expected to accelerate the adoption of RO membrane systems across municipal and industrial applications.
Development of Low-Energy and High-Performance Membranes Strengthens Market Forecast
The development of low-energy and high-performance membranes is strengthening the market forecast for the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Advances in membrane materials and energy recovery technologies are improving system efficiency while reducing operating costs across desalination and water treatment applications.
Renewable Energy-Powered Desalination Creates New Growth Opportunities
Renewable energy-powered desalination is creating new opportunities in the re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market. Integrating renewable energy sources with RO systems is supporting sustainable freshwater production while reducing energy-related operating costs.

By Filter Module Type
“Spiral Wound segment accounted for the largest market share in 2024 and is further expected to be the fastest-growing segment during the forecast period.”
- The reverse osmosis (RO) membrane market is segmented by filter module type into plate & frame, tubular, spiral wound, and hollow fiber.
- Spiral Wound segment accounted for the largest market share in 2024 and is further expected to be the fastest-growing segment during the forecast period, due to its structural design and operational benefits. These filter modules' structure expands the membrane surface area in a small area. Due to these characteristics, spiral wounds are very effective in processes like desalination and wastewater treatment.
- Moreover, the spiral-wound filter modules also guarantee high-quality water flow rates with efficient salt and impurity removal, making them suitable for large-scale applications like desalination plants.
